The NIFTY 50 figure is the index itself over the same dates, which like this page counts price only and no dividends — so the two are measured the same way. The fixed deposit line assumes a steady 6.5% a year for the whole period. No bank held one rate that long: Indian deposit rates ran from around 9% in 2014 to about 5.5% in 2021. Treat it as a yardstick, not a record of what a deposit actually paid.

How this was worked out

₹10,000 at ₹64.40 a share buys 155.28 shares. Held to the close of 11 Sep 2026 at ₹514.50, those shares are worth ₹79,891. Dividends are not included, and neither are brokerage, taxes or charges — the real figure would differ on both counts.

Data covers 19 May 2016 to 11 Sep 2026 (2,556 trading days), from end-of-day NSE prices. This page is a record of what prices did. It is not advice, and nothing here is a recommendation to buy or sell — read the disclaimer.
